Actually the law specifies you can have tints in the front but it has to be 88% visible. My moms Q45 has factory tints on the front two windows, they are completely legal and they are a very very light tint.

So if there is a very light tint that only permits 88% of light or more to shine through then its legal. Just like the stock benzes that have the blue tint.
